Flower: Pink-and-white lady's slipper (Cypripedium reginae) The pink-and-white lady's slipper is found in swamps, bogs, and damp woods. It has largely disappeared due to habitat loss; as one of Minnesota's rarest wildflowers, the lady's slipper is illegal to pick in the state. [13] [14] 1967 Fruit: Honeycrisp apple (Malus pumila)
